Tbo ship Commodore, although having given notice not to sail until today, suddenly slipped out at ono o'clock yesterday afternoon with 3100 tons of sugar valued at 8190,201 for Now York. Mate Murray of tho bark Mohi can that is on its way to Hono lulu on the Welch & Co lino has lost his position through au anonymous letter sent to Welch it Co. Tbo letter accused Murray of having fifty pounds of opium on board that be intended to smuggle into Honolulu. Tbo following vessels have ar rived in San Francisco: From Honolulu, tbo bark Albert 21 days and schooner Transit 29 days on Aug 5; tho barkentine 8 N Castle 20 days and brigt W O Trwin 19 days on Aug 0; tho bark S O Al len 22 days on Aug 11; from Ma bukona, tbo brigt J D Spreckols 21 days and the schooner Anna 30 days on Aug 11. Tbo irrepressible Captain Alex ander McLean is again in com mand of a vessel and is going to the South Seas ostensibly on a trading cruiso. Tbo newly formed South Sea Commercial Company has purchased theflppt and stanch sealer Sopbia Sutherland from William Sutherland iiud will send her to differents points in tbo Fiji, Caroline, Marshall and Gilbort groups. Captain McLean is not altogether unknown in theso isl ands. PABHENOERS ARRIVED. From Kuuni, per stmr Koan bou, Aug 21 Mrs Hart and 8 deck. ' PASSENGERS DEPARTED.
